Does the Audi A3 hold value?

Do Audi A3 Hold Their Value? While the Audi A3 does experience typical depreciation, it tends to retain a strong resale value in the long run. On average, the A3 maintains about 43% of its original value at the five-year mark and 31% at ten years. We recommend the 2013, 2019, 2020, or 2022 selections if you want the best value. We hope this information is beneficial!What’s the difference between an Audi A1 and an A3? The A3 is larger than the A1 with more rear seat and boot space.
